HSPs drive dichotomous T-cell immune responses via DNA methylome remodelling in antigen presenting cells.
Nature communications - 31 May 2017
Kinner-Bibeau Lauren B, Sedlacek Abigail L, Messmer Michelle N, Watkins Simon C, Binder Robert J
Abstract excerpt
Immune responses primed by endogenous heat shock proteins, specifically gp96, can be varied, and mechanisms controlling these responses have not been defined. Immunization with low doses of gp96 primes T helper type 1 (Th1) immune responses, whereas high-dose immunization primes responses characterized by regulatory T (Treg) cells and immunosuppression.
